Basketball Stars vs Football Strike: Which Multiplayer Soccer Game Reigns Supreme?

 
 

    As a longtime mobile gaming enthusiast who has spent countless hours testing multiplayer sports games, I find myself constantly comparing two standout titles: Basketball Stars and Football Strike. Both games have dominated their respective app store charts, but the question remains—which one truly deserves the crown?     Having played both games extensively since their releases, I can confidently say that Football Strike's shooting mechanics feel more polished and realistic. The ball physics are remarkably sophisticated—when you swipe to shoot, you can actually feel the difference between a gentle tap and a powerful strike. I've recorded over 200 hours playing Football Strike, and what keeps me coming back is the incredible satisfaction of curling a perfect free kick into the top corner. The multiplayer matches are genuinely thrilling, especially when you're facing off against skilled opponents in penalty shootouts. There's this tangible tension that builds up during those crucial moments that few mobile games manage to replicate effectively.

    Meanwhile, Basketball Stars offers a completely different kind of appeal. The dribbling system is surprisingly deep, allowing for complex combinations of crossovers and spin moves that can completely break an opponent's ankles. I've found myself spending hours just practicing different dribble sequences in the training mode. The one-on-one street basketball vibe gives it this urban authenticity that resonates with fans of playground basketball culture. However, I must admit the game's shooting mechanics sometimes feel less consistent than Football Strike's—there were numerous occasions where I felt my release timing was perfect, yet the ball would still rim out inexplicably.

    When it comes to multiplayer engagement, both games have their strengths, but I'm leaning toward Football Strike for its superior matchmaking system. The game consistently pairs me with opponents of similar skill levels, creating balanced and competitive matches. Basketball Stars, while fun, sometimes suffers from matching newcomers against veterans, leading to frustratingly one-sided games. From a visual standpoint, both games deliver impressive graphics, though Basketball Stars' character animations feel slightly more fluid, especially during dunk sequences. The customization options in both games are extensive, but I've probably spent more real money on Basketball Stars' sneaker collection—those limited edition Jordans are just too tempting to pass up.

    What truly sets these games apart, in my experience, is their approach to competitive play. Football Strike's tournament mode creates this incredible sense of progression that keeps players invested for the long haul. The ranking system feels meaningful, and climbing those global leaderboards becomes genuinely addictive. Basketball Stars focuses more on quick, casual matches, which works perfectly for shorter gaming sessions but lacks the same depth in its competitive structure. Both games receive regular updates, but Football Strike's developers seem more responsive to community feedback, implementing requested features within 2-3 months on average compared to Basketball Stars' 4-6 month turnaround.

    After hundreds of matches in both games, I've concluded that Football Strike narrowly edges out Basketball Stars for the multiplayer soccer game throne. The precision of its controls, the consistency of its gameplay mechanics, and the depth of its competitive features create a more compelling overall package. That said, Basketball Stars remains an excellent alternative for players who prefer basketball or want faster-paced matches.
